Sands of Kahana is a Full-Service Oceanfront Resort on Kahana Beach
Sands of Kahana is one of the larger condo-resort complexes on the West Maui coast — 196 units across four buildings on roughly seven acres of oceanfront grounds in Kahana, midway between Kaʻanapali and Kapalua.
The property runs more like a hotel than a typical condo building: 24-hour front desk, on-site dining, an activities concierge, and a recreation lineup that includes two swimming pools, two hot tubs, lighted tennis and pickleball courts, a 9-hole putting green, basketball and volleyball courts, and kayak and paddleboard rentals directly from the beach.
The unit sizes back up the resort-scale amenities — layouts range from 1-bedroom to 3-bedroom configurations, with the larger units running over 2,000 square feet including penthouse loft designs.

Sands of Kahana charges a resort fee of $75, paid directly to the on-site front desk at check-in. This covers the full run of resort amenities — pools, courts, equipment, fitness centers, and beach access.
While Sands of Kahana is situated right on the water, beach sizes in Maui are prone to seasonal shifts and tide changes.
The beach at the property is sandy at the waterline with a barrier reef roughly 100 yards offshore. The reef creates calm, protected water inside the break — snorkeling conditions that bring guests back to the property beach rather than driving to other spots.
Napili Bay is a 5 minute drive north for calmer protected water and consistent turtle sightings. D.T. Fleming Beach Park — wide golden sand, among Hawaiʻi’s best beaches — is about 10 minutes north. Local Kahana dining includes Miso Phat Sushi (featured on Diners, Drive-Ins and Dives), Dollie’s Pub & Cafe, and Merriman’s Kapalua a few minutes further north for farm-to-table dining with ocean views.
